Jack rv antenna

I have replaced my factory antenna with the Jack rv antenna several months ago. I bought 2 antennas, one for the rig and another for a stand alone install where I store my rig. The one in the rig is working fine. My problem is trying to locate where I left the power amplifier that came with both the antennas. I can`t believe I`ve misplaced 2 amplifiers. I need this part for the stand alone antenna to hook up to my external tv coax connection. I have a cover over my rig so I can not raise the roof mount antenna. Hence the stand alone unit.
So I`ve been all over the internet trying to find another power amplifier for the antenna with no luck. The one that came with the antenna is a 120v to 12v converter with power booster.
So my question is, will any amplifier work for this , or do I need to stick with the original amplifier if I can find one?

If you come across your manual you will see : Power Injector (included)
• KING #PB1000 - power supply, white. .... Google that and you will find many rv stores that carry them for about $20. The booster in your rv from the Wineguard will power the one on the trailer just fine. JM2¢, Hank

These are 12v dc but you can always power them fro the trailer.
